| def linear_search_array(nums: list[int], target: int) -> int:
 | |
|     """线性查找(数组)"""
 | |
|     # 遍历数组
 | |
|     for i in range(len(nums)):
 | |
|         if nums[i] == target:  # 找到目标元素,返回其索引
 | |
|             return i
 | |
|     return -1  # 未找到目标元素,返回 -1
 | |
| 
 | |
| 
 | |
| def linear_search_linkedlist(head: ListNode, target: int) -> ListNode | None:
 | |
|     """线性查找(链表)"""
 | |
|     # 遍历链表
 | |
|     while head:
 | |
|         if head.val == target:  # 找到目标节点,返回之
 | |
|             return head
 | |
|         head = head.next
 | |
|     return None  # 未找到目标节点,返回 None
